.share-page{display:flex;flex-direction:column;height:100vh;min-height:300px;overflow-y:auto}.share-page .header{font-size:24px;font-weight:700;margin-top:20px;text-align:center}.share-page .content{flex:1;padding:20px 20px 80px}.share-page .content .article .paragraph{font-size:16px;line-height:1.5;margin-bottom:15px;text-indent:2em}.share-page .entrance{margin:24px 23px}.share-page .share-button-area{padding-bottom:50px}.share-page .footer{flex-direction:column;margin-top:50px;padding:0 13px}.share-page .footer,.share-page .footer .share-button{align-items:center;display:flex;justify-content:center}.share-page .footer .share-button{min-width:100px}.share-page .footer .share-button-text{font-size:15px;font-weight:500;line-height:23px}.share-page .footer .footer-power{color:#ccc;font-size:11px;margin:10px 15px 20px;text-align:center}.share-page .share-area{align-items:flex-start;display:flex;justify-content:flex-end}.share-page .share-image{height:130px;margin:10px 55px 0 0;width:215px}
